Efimenko, Anna Vladimirovna

Anna Vladimirovna Efimenko (born 1980) is a Russian athlete, a three-time silver medalist and a bronze medalist at the XIII Summer Paralympic Games 2008 in Beijing in swimming. Four-time champion of Russia. Master of Sports of international class [1] .

Biography

Anna Vladimirovna Efimenko was born on March 9, 1980 in Volgograd . She began to engage in sports at the School of Higher Sportsmanship of the Moscow Region.

Education and Careers

She graduated from the Volgograd State Academy of Physical Culture with a degree in physical education and sports. Currently working as a swimming coach in the Cultural and Sports Rehabilitation Complex of the All-Russian Society of the Blind [2] .

Awards

Awarded the Order of Friendship [3] .

Beijing 2008

She participated in the final four heats. At a distance of 50, 100 and 400 m, the crawl won silver medals. At a distance of 50 m on the back won the bronze. [four]
